חדשות

איך לבחור נכון: יותר מ-550 כלים חינמיים ובעלות נמוכה לפיתוח יישומי LLM וסוכני AI

ריכזנו עבורכם אוסף מעודכן של מאות כלים חינמיים ובעלות נמוכה לפיתוח יישומי מודלי שפה גדולים וסוכני AI – מתי ולמה כדאי להשתמש בהם, ומה חשוב לדעת לפני שמתחילים.

11 באפריל 20263 דקות קריאה
איך לבחור נכון: יותר מ-550 כלים חינמיים ובעלות נמוכה לפיתוח יישומי LLM וסוכני AI

קרדיט: Reddit Artificial Intelligence

פיתוח יישומים מבוססי מודלי שפה גדולים (LLM) מציב בפני מפתחים אתגר כפול: מצד אחד, יש צורך בגישה למגוון רחב של כלים מתקדמים; מצד שני, העלויות והמורכבות הטכנולוגית עלולות להקשות על פרויקטים קטנים ובינוניים. האוסף שלנו, הכולל מעל 550 כלי AI חינמיים או בעלות נמוכה, נועד לתת מענה ממשי לאתגר הזה – אך חשוב להבין מתי וכיצד להשתמש בכלים הללו בצורה אפקטיבית.

הכלים באוסף מחולקים לכמה קטגוריות מרכזיות:

1. ממשקי API (Application Programming Interfaces) – מאפשרים גישה נוחה למודלי שפה חזקים של חברות מובילות, עם יתרון של עדכון מתמיד ותחזוקה חיצונית. מפתחים יכולים לשלב יכולות AI מתקדמות במהירות, אך יש לקחת בחשבון תלות בשירותי ענן ועלויות משתנות בהתאם לשימוש.

2. מודלים מקומיים (Local Models) – מאפשרים להריץ מודלים על חומרה מקומית, מה שמעניק שליטה מלאה על הנתונים, פרטיות גבוהה יותר והפחתת תלות בחיבור אינטרנטי. עם זאת, הפעלת מודלים אלה דורשת משאבים טכניים משמעותיים וידע מקצועי, והם לרוב פחות עדכניים או מדויקים מהמודלים בענן.

3. RAG (Retrieval Augmented Generation) – טכניקה המשלבת אחזור מידע חיצוני בזמן אמת עם יצירת טקסט, מה שמאפשר ליישומים לספק תגובות מבוססות על מידע עדכני ומותאם להקשר. זהו כלי חשוב במיוחד למפתחים שצריכים לשלב ידע דינמי ומעודכן מעבר לידע הסטטי של המודל.

4. סוכני AI (Agents) – מערכות אוטונומיות שמבצעות משימות מורכבות באמצעות תכנון, אינטראקציה עם כלים חיצוניים וקבלת החלטות עצמאית. פיתוח סוכנים כאלה מתאים למי שמחפש לבנות מערכות חכמות עם יכולות פעולה עצמאיות, אך דורש מיומנויות מתקדמות ותכנון מוקפד.

מה המשמעות למפתחים ולבוני סוכני AI?

הקיום של מגוון רחב כל כך של כלים משקף את רמת הבשלות והפיזור של טכנולוגיות ה-LLM כיום. זהו לא רק עניין של כלים, אלא של בחירה נכונה בהתאמה לצרכים, משאבים ומטרות הפרויקט. מפתחים צריכים להעריך את רמת המורכבות שהם מוכנים להתמודד איתה, את דרישות הפרטיות והביצועים, ואת התקציב הזמין.

מתי להשתמש בכלים האלו?

  • כשמחפשים פתרון מהיר לשלב AI ביישום, ממשקי API הם הבחירה המובילה.
  • כשדרושה שליטה מלאה בנתונים או עבודה בסביבה מבודדת, מודלים מקומיים מתאימים יותר.
  • כשנדרשת תגובה מבוססת מידע עדכני ורלוונטי, טכניקות RAG הן הכרחיות.
  • כשמתכננים מערכות עם אוטונומיה גבוהה, כדאי להשקיע בפיתוח סוכני AI.

מתי להיזהר?

  • אם התקציב מוגבל מאוד, חשוב לבדוק היטב את עלויות השימוש בממשקי API.
  • אם אין ניסיון טכני מתאים, הפעלת מודלים מקומיים או סוכנים אוטונומיים עלולה להיות מאתגרת.
  • יש להקפיד על בדיקות אבטחה ופרטיות, במיוחד כשעובדים עם נתונים רגישים.

המסר המרכזי הוא: אוסף הכלים הרחב קיים, אך ההצלחה תלויה בבחירה מושכלת ובהבנת המגבלות והיתרונות של כל פתרון. מפתחים ויזמים צריכים להתמקד בבניית תשתית שמתאימה לצרכיהם, ולא להיסחף אחרי כל חדשנות זמינה.

הכלים הללו הם לא קסם, אלא אמצעי – והבחירה הנכונה בהם יכולה להקפיץ את הפרויקט שלכם קדימה, לחסוך זמן ועלויות, ולשפר את חוויית המשתמש. לכן, לפני שמתחילים, חשוב להגדיר מטרות ברורות, להבין את דרישות הפרויקט, ולבחון את הכלים בהתאם לכך.